Last Updated at 11 October 2024SAHAPUR J.N. PRY: A Comprehensive Overview of a Rural Primary School in West Bengal
SAHAPUR J.N. PRY, a government-run primary school, stands as a vital educational institution in the rural landscape of West Bengal. Established in 1999 under the Department of Education, this co-educational school caters to students from Class 1 to Class 4, offering a crucial foundation for their academic journeys. Located in the BELDANGA-I block of MURSHIDABAD district, its accessibility via all-weather roads ensures consistent attendance for its students.
The school's infrastructure includes a government-provided building, equipped with four well-maintained classrooms designed for effective learning. Beyond the classrooms, additional space accommodates non-teaching activities, including a dedicated room for administrative and teacher use. The partially completed boundary wall provides a degree of security, while the presence of electricity ensures a modern learning environment.
Providing essential amenities, SAHAPUR J.N. PRY boasts a functional library stocked with 370 books, fostering a love for reading among its young learners. Clean drinking water is readily available through hand pumps, addressing a fundamental health and hygiene requirement. Furthermore, the school has separate, functional boys' and girls' toilets, promoting a sanitary and comfortable learning experience for all students.
The school's academic program is conducted in Bengali, the local language, fostering a sense of connection and familiarity for the students. Three male teachers dedicate their expertise to impart knowledge and shape the future of their students. A noteworthy feature is the inclusion of a pre-primary section, providing early childhood education to prepare younger children for formal schooling. The school operates on an annual academic calendar beginning in April, adhering to the standard West Bengal academic schedule.
A key aspect of the school's commitment to its students is the provision of midday meals, prepared and served on the school premises. This initiative ensures that students receive proper nutrition, supporting their physical and cognitive development. The school, however, does not offer computer-aided learning or possess computers for educational purposes, which represents an area for potential future development. The school's commitment to accessibility is demonstrated through ramps for disabled students, guaranteeing inclusivity in learning.
